How do you upload a skin to Minecraft Java?

Here's how to get started:
  1. Open the original Java Edition launcher.
  2. Go to the Skins menu.
  3. Select the Browse button.
  4. Click Select A File to open Windows Explorer.
  5. Go and find the skin you want to use.
  6. Select Open to use the skin.
  7. Click Save to apply the settings.
  8. Close the original Java Edition launcher.

How do you upload skins to Minecraft?

Upload a custom skin to Minecraft for Windows

Select Dressing Room under your current character. Select the menu button at the top-left of the screen for more options, and then select Classic Skins. Select the blank skin model under Owned Skins, and then select Choose New Skin. Upload your custom skin .

Why can't i upload skins to Minecraft?

You need to upload your preferred skin through your Mojang account on Mojang's website and login with the same account in the Minecraft launcher. And then, the skin will only show up if you're connected to the Internet.

Why is everyone Steve and Alex in Minecraft?

Why is everyone Steve or Alex in Minecraft? If everyone turns into Steve or Alex, the default skins, in Minecraft, it means there's been a glitch. Incompatible software can cause this glitch, as can a spotty internet connection that renders the game unable to load its features.

How do you turn on trusted skins in Minecraft?

To see some skins of other players, you may need to disable "Only Allow Trusted Skins" under Settings>Profile. If your friends cannot see your skin, they should check the toggle on their profile. What file type does a Minecraft skin use?

Minecraft skins are 64x64* pixel image files in PNG format. These tell the Minecraft software what color to generate pixels and at what opacity on the in-game avatar's model.

How do I import custom skins?

Uploading Custom Skins to Minecraft

For Minecraft for Windows 10 and mobile versions of Minecraft, you can upload your own custom skin by going to Profile > Classic Skins > Owned > Import.
